Lord Byron (Gabriel Byrne), Percy Bysshe Shelley (Julian Sands), Mary Godwin Shelley (Natasha Richardson) and other literary luminaries gather at a Geneva villa on 16 June 1816 for a night of weird frenzy during the storm that inspired Shelley to write Frankenstein.
There are eerie séances, orgies galore, thunder and lightning, rats in the wine cellar, mind-blowing hallucinations – all laid on thick and eloquent by director Ken Russell who wallows in the excess. Yet it’s all just so much garish gibberish – uninvolving and hard to sort out.
